FirstService Residential is proud to be providing property management service to the Legends Private Residence, located in the vibrant ICE District Canada’s largest mixed-use sports and entertainment district.   The Maintenance Assistant will be responsible to preserve the excellent condition and functionality of the premises. Reporting to the Senior Building Operator, Community Manager, and assisting the janitorial staff. The Maintenance Assistant's duties will include; conducting elevator monitoring services, janitorial services, inspections, garbage and recycling program, changing light bulbs, minor repairs, snow removal, as well as providing exceptional customer service to Clients. 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:  The job duties listed are typical examples of the work performed by positions in this job classification. Not all duties assigned to every position are included, nor is it expected that all positions will be assigned every duty:
  • Complete elevator monitoring services for the freight elevator for all move in/outs & deliveries (average 20 hours per week)
  • Providing an orientation of the loading dock and filling out condition checklists.
  • Complete garbage disposal and recycling disposal 5 times a week.
  • Conduct inspections on all site mechanical site common areas, electrical, and HVAC systems and related equipment.
  • Conduct amenity room inspections prior to and after bookings, ensuring the condition of the space is adequately documented before the event and following it.
  • Padding elevators for use during a move.
  • Complete work orders in a timely manner as assigned.
  • Follow preventative maintenance schedules and procedures.
  • Meeting contractors on site, providing access and orientation to the Property.
  • Continuous review of the mechanical rooms and hazardous locations.
  • Adhere to all health, safety and security procedure and report areas of concern to the appropriate parties.
  • Maintain the inventory records for equipment and supplies.
  • Responsible for providing coverage in the absence of other Maintenance Technicians.
  • Miscellaneous janitorial tasks.
  • Other related duties as assigned.
